According to the IKBD specs from Atari, sending 0x80 0x01 resets the
keyboard, which performs a self-test.  If the test is successful, the
ikbd will return a code of 0xF0 within 300ms.

That must be an old spec file... The lowest nibble in that byte
actually tells you the version number of the IKBD ROM. Only very early
STs (I guess the 520 series?) returned 0xF0, all newer versions return
0xF1 instead (IIRC I also saw this on my 1040 STf).


Hi,

my old 520 STF, single side drive version from 1986, returns 0xF1, so maybe it was the very early 520 with external rom on floppy that returned 0xF0 ?
